You rock!… Smiles, Cara :) On Jan 19, 2011, at 2:24 PM, Rynhardt Kruger wrote: Hi Cara, One thing I've found is that you can get the same result by swapping the arguments to atan2. Using your variable names, angle=atan2(vectorX,vectorY)*180/M_PI; if (angle<0) angle+=360; Take care, Rynhardt * Cara Quinn <caraqu...@draconisentertainment.com> [110119 23:47]: > Thomas et al; > > It occurred to me, that during our last discussion of 3D mapping etc, that > you'd asked how I was converting my arc tangent result to a bearing with zero > being north and degrees ascending clockwise. Here's how I do it. this is my > own way, and is only for a flat plane which is perfect for games. There are > other formulae out there, but they take into account earth curvature. This is > not as elegant as I'd like, but is less expensive than other formulae. > -Perhaps someone else knows of a better formula?? -Would love to hear!? :) > > Anyway, this way is very simple.
